60 lines
1.9 KiB
Makefile
60 lines
1.9 KiB
Makefile
# $NetBSD: Makefile,v 1.11 2015/03/04 19:48:16 tnn2 Exp $
|
|
|
|
DISTNAME= lightspark-0.7.2
|
|
CATEGORIES= multimedia
|
|
MASTER_SITES= https://launchpad.net/lightspark/trunk/lightspark-0.7.2/+download/
|
|
|
|
MAINTAINER= nathanialsloss@yahoo.com.au
|
|
LICENSE= gnu-gpl-v3
|
|
HOMEPAGE= https://launchpad.net/lightspark/
|
|
COMMENT= GPL AMV2 Flash player and plugin
|
|
|
|
DEPENDS+= xdg-utils>=1.0:../../misc/xdg-utils
|
|
|
|
USE_LANGUAGES= c c++
|
|
USE_CMAKE= yes
|
|
USE_TOOLS+= pkg-config
|
|
GCC_REQD+= 4.6
|
|
AUTO_MKDIRS= yes
|
|
EGDIR= ${PREFIX}/share/examples/lightspark
|
|
CMAKE_ARGS+= -DGNASH_EXE_PATH:STRING="${PREFIX}/bin/gnash"
|
|
|
|
.include "../../mk/compiler.mk"
|
|
|
|
.if !empty(PKGSRC_COMPILER:Mclang)
|
|
CXXFLAGS+= -stdlib=libc++
|
|
CXXFLAGS+= -std=c++0x
|
|
.endif
|
|
|
|
pre-configure:
|
|
${LN} -s ${LLVM_CONFIG_PATH} ${TOOLS_DIR}/bin/llvm-config
|
|
|
|
post-install:
|
|
${MV} ${DESTDIR}${PREFIX}/etc/xdg ${DESTDIR}${EGDIR} && \
|
|
${RMDIR} ${DESTDIR}${PREFIX}/etc
|
|
|
|
CONF_FILES= ${EGDIR}/xdg/lightspark.conf ${PKG_SYSCONFDIR}/xdg/lightspark.conf
|
|
|
|
DEPENDS+= gnash>=0.8.10:../../multimedia/gnash
|
|
BUILD_DEPENDS+= nasm>=2.10:../../devel/nasm
|
|
BUILDLINK_API_DEPENDS.xz+= xz>=5.0.5
|
|
.include "../../archivers/xz/buildlink3.mk"
|
|
.include "../../audio/pulseaudio/buildlink3.mk"
|
|
.include "../../devel/boost-libs/buildlink3.mk"
|
|
.include "../../devel/glibmm/buildlink3.mk"
|
|
.include "../../graphics/glew/buildlink3.mk"
|
|
.include "../../graphics/glu/buildlink3.mk"
|
|
.include "../../graphics/hicolor-icon-theme/buildlink3.mk"
|
|
.include "../../mk/jpeg.buildlink3.mk"
|
|
.include "../../lang/libLLVM34/buildlink3.mk"
|
|
.include "../../multimedia/ffmpeg010/buildlink3.mk"
|
|
.include "../../net/rtmpdump/buildlink3.mk"
|
|
.include "../../sysutils/desktop-file-utils/desktopdb.mk"
|
|
.include "../../textproc/libxml++/buildlink3.mk"
|
|
.include "../../www/curl/buildlink3.mk"
|
|
.include "../../lang/compiler-rt/buildlink3.mk"
|
|
.include "../../x11/gtk2/buildlink3.mk"
|
|
|
|
.include "../../mk/pthread.buildlink3.mk"
|
|
.include "../../mk/bsd.pkg.mk"
|